First, a Quick Refresher: What Eczema and Psoriasis Have in Common

Eczema (atopic dermatitis) and psoriasis are different conditions with different underlying biology. Eczema involves a compromised skin barrier and an overactive immune response that leaves skin dry, itchy, and inflamed. Psoriasis is an autoimmune condition in which skin cells multiply far faster than normal, building up into raised, scaly plaques.

What they share is chronic inflammation — and that overlap is exactly why light-based treatments have been part of dermatology for decades. Phototherapy is a well-established, dermatologist-administered treatment for both conditions. The key question is whether red light specifically — the kind delivered by at-home LED devices — offers some of those benefits without the drawbacks of ultraviolet exposure.

How Red Light Therapy Works on Inflamed Skin

Red light therapy, also called photobiomodulation, delivers specific wavelengths of visible red light (typically around 630–660nm) and near-infrared light (typically 800–1,100nm) into the skin. Unlike the UV light used in traditional phototherapy, these wavelengths don't damage DNA and don't tan or burn the skin.

Instead, research suggests the light is absorbed by cytochrome c oxidase, an enzyme inside your cells' mitochondria. That absorption appears to nudge cells toward producing more ATP — cellular energy — while also modulating inflammatory signaling. For inflammatory skin conditions, three of red light's studied effects are especially relevant:

1. Calming inflammatory signaling

Multiple studies have observed reductions in pro-inflammatory cytokines after photobiomodulation. Since both eczema and psoriasis are driven by inflammatory cascades, this is the central mechanism researchers are exploring.

2. Supporting the skin barrier

Red light has been shown to support fibroblast activity and collagen production — the repair machinery of the skin. For eczema-prone skin, where a weakened barrier lets moisture out and irritants in, barrier support is a meaningful target.

3. Slowing excess skin cell turnover

This one is specific to psoriasis. A 2025 study published in Scientific Reports found that LED red light attenuated epidermal thickening and slowed the runaway keratinocyte proliferation that creates psoriatic plaques — in laboratory psoriasis models. It's preclinical work, but it points to a plausible mechanism beyond general inflammation control.

What the Research Shows for Psoriasis

The most frequently cited human study is a 2010 pilot by dermatologist Dr. Glynis Ablon, published in Photomedicine and Laser Surgery. Patients with recalcitrant psoriasis — plaques that had resisted conventional treatments — received LED sessions combining 830nm near-infrared and 633nm red light twice weekly for four to five weeks.

The results were striking for such a stubborn patient group: clearance rates of plaques ranged from 60% to 100%, patient satisfaction was universally high, and no significant side effects were reported. The honest caveat: this was a small preliminary study without a placebo control group, and the author herself called for larger randomized trials. More than a decade later, those large trials are still limited — which is why dermatologists describe red light for psoriasis as promising rather than proven.

Reviews in the Journal of Clinical and Aesthetic Dermatology have echoed this framing: LED phototherapy shows a consistently strong safety profile and encouraging results across inflammatory skin conditions, but the evidence base remains built on small studies.

What the Research Shows for Eczema

The eczema evidence is earlier-stage than the psoriasis data. Most established phototherapy research for atopic dermatitis involves narrowband UVB — a clinical treatment that works through different mechanisms than red light and carries UV-related risks that require medical supervision.

For red light specifically, small studies and case series have reported reduced itch, less visible irritation, and improvement in eczema severity scores, and researchers point to red light's documented anti-inflammatory and barrier-supporting effects as the likely explanation. A 2021 review of phototherapy for atopic eczema noted that while light-based treatment clearly helps many patients, head-to-head data on newer modalities — including LED red light — is still sparse.

In plain terms: red light therapy for eczema is biologically plausible, appears low-risk, and has encouraging early signals, but it does not yet have the deep clinical evidence base that established eczema treatments have. Anyone with moderate to severe eczema should treat it as a possible complement to medical care, not an alternative.

Red Light vs. Traditional Phototherapy: An Important Distinction

It's easy to conflate the two, and worth being precise:

Clinical UV phototherapy

Narrowband UVB, administered in a dermatologist's office, is a gold-standard treatment for widespread eczema and psoriasis. It works partly by suppressing overactive immune cells in the skin. Because UV light carries cumulative risks, treatment is dosed and monitored by professionals.

At-home red light therapy

Red and near-infrared LEDs emit no UV. They won't burn, tan, or add to your lifetime UV exposure, which is why well-made devices are cleared for home use. The tradeoff is a gentler mechanism: red light supports and calms the skin rather than suppressing the immune system. If your dermatologist has recommended UV phototherapy, red light is not a substitute for it — though many patients use both, with their doctor's knowledge.

Using Red Light Therapy at Home With Eczema or Psoriasis

If you and your dermatologist decide red light is worth trying, a few practical principles improve your odds of a good experience:

Choose clinically relevant wavelengths

The psoriasis research that exists used red light around 633nm combined with near-infrared at 830nm — so look for a device that delivers both a red wavelength in the 630–660nm range and a near-infrared component. Be consistent, not aggressive

Study protocols typically involved short sessions several times per week over four to eight weeks. More is not better — photobiomodulation follows a dose-response curve where excessive exposure can blunt results. Ten to twenty minutes, three to five times weekly, mirrors most research protocols. Start gently during flares

Inflamed skin is reactive skin. Introduce red light on calmer days first, watch how your skin responds for 24 hours, and skip sessions over broken, weeping, or infected skin entirely. Patch-testing a small area is never a bad idea with either condition.

Keep your existing routine

When to See a Dermatologist Instead

Red light therapy is a supportive tool, not a treatment plan. See a professional promptly if your eczema or psoriasis is spreading or worsening, if plaques crack or bleed, if itch is disrupting sleep, if you notice signs of skin infection, or if joint pain accompanies psoriasis — that can signal psoriatic arthritis, which needs medical management. No home device addresses the systemic side of these conditions.

Frequently Asked Questions

Can red light therapy make eczema or psoriasis worse?

Reported side effects in studies are rare and mild — occasional temporary redness or warmth. That said, any stimulus can irritate skin mid-flare. Introduce sessions gradually, and stop if your skin consistently feels worse afterward.

How long does red light therapy take to work on psoriasis?

In the Ablon pilot study, patients received treatment for four to five weeks before results were assessed. Most photobiomodulation research suggests giving any protocol at least four to eight consistent weeks before judging it.

Is red light therapy the same as the phototherapy my dermatologist offers?

No. Clinical phototherapy for eczema and psoriasis typically uses narrowband UVB — ultraviolet light that suppresses immune activity and requires medical supervision. Red light LEDs contain no UV and work through gentler, mitochondria-mediated mechanisms.

Can I use red light therapy on my face if I have eczema there?

Facial skin responds well to red light in studies of other inflammatory conditions like rosacea and acne, and LED masks are designed for facial use. Avoid active weeping or infected patches, keep sessions short at first, and clear it with your dermatologist if you use prescription facial topicals.

Does insurance cover red light therapy for skin conditions?

Generally no — at-home LED devices are considered wellness purchases. Clinical UV phototherapy, by contrast, is often covered when prescribed.
